How We Extract Water from Your Subfloor

A proper subfloor water extraction process is crucial for preventing further damage and ensuring a thorough dry-out. That’s why our team follows a meticulous, step-by-step approach. We’ll never cut corners or rush through the process – your property deserves better. By taking the time to do it right, we’ll give you peace of mind and ensure your home is safe to occupy as soon as possible.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

We’ll carefully assess the extent of the damage, identifying the source of the water and determining the best course of action for extraction.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ect moisture and identify any hidden issues.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ible from the subfloor.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of secondary water dam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ring the subfloor is completely dry.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

We’ll use EPA-registered disinfectants to sanitize and disinfect the affected area, removing any remaining bacteria and other microorganisms.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the subfloor is completely dry and there are no remaining issues. We’ll also clean up any debris and materials that were affected by the water damage.

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Extraction

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ice persistent musty odors in your home, it may be a sign of hidden moisture. Don’t ignore it – this can lead to mold growth and further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age beneath. Don’t delay – this can spread and cause more extensive dam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age behind the surface. Don’t ignore it – this can lead to more extensive damage and costly repairs.

Cracked or Broken Tiles

Cracked or broken tiles can be a sign of water damage beneath. Don’t delay – this can spread and cause more extensive damage.

Stains or Discoloration on Walls or Ceilings

St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it – this can lead to mold growth and further damage.

Unpleasant Moisture or Humidity

Unpleasant moisture or humidity in your home can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t delay – this can lead to mold growth and further damage.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ost in Hephzibah, GA

The cost of subfloor water extraction in Hephzibah, GA var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action and provide a customized quote for your project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Inspection $200-$500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Water Extraction $500-$2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000-$3,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500-$1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Final Inspection and Cleanup $200-$500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ed

Common Questions About Subfloor Water Extraction

Q: Is subfloor water extraction covered by insurance?

A: Yes, subfloor water extraction is typically covered by homeowners insurance. But, the specifics dep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action and help you navigate the claims process.

Q: How long does subfloor water extraction take?

A: The length of time it takes to complete subfloor water extraction dep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. In most cases, we can complete the job within 3-5 days.

Q: Is subfloor water extraction safe for my family and pets?

A: Yes, subfloor water extraction is safe for your family and pets when done properly. We use EPA-registered disinfectants and follow strict safety protocols to ensure a safe and healthy environment.

Q: Can I prevent subfloor water extraction by taking certain precautions?

A: Yes, you can take steps to prevent subfloor water extraction by checking for hidden moisture, fixing leaks quickly, and using a dehumidifier in humid areas. We can also provide you with tips and recommendations for maintaining a dry and healthy subfloor.

Q: What happens if I ignore subfloor water extraction?

A: Ignoring subfloor water extraction can lead to more extensive damage, mold growth, and health risks.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further complications and costly repairs.
